I joined here looking for information about the mid 80's Bluesbirds with the EMG's, Kahler trems and 6 on a side headstock. Wayyyy back in the distant past, I remember seeing pictures of both Brian Setzer and Earl Slick with these guitars, and at the time remember some quick references in magazine articles etc. of a Setzer designed Bluesbird...I recently have a renewed interest in these guitars,( Don't laugh ! I'm getting nostalgic for the mid 80's in my old age !) but information and photographs about them seems very thin on the ground .
I got as far as a tribute site for the Nightbird that shows a scan of the Guild pricelist and it mentions a Setzer designed model with 3 pickups and a 799.00 price tag.
Does anybody here have some pics or information about these guitars ? There are a couple for sale presently on Ebay, including a black one with a refin and trem coverted to hardtail which seems to have been all over the 'net, as well as a red model with some sort of blade pickups.
